Scientific Career
-
Since 10/2025: Junior Research Group Leader, TU Dresden, IfWW, MBC Dresden, Chair of Biomaterials, Group Functional Biomaterials (PD. Dr. Vera Hintze)
-
07/2021 – 09/2025: Temporary Principal Investigator for DFG project number: 460388836, TU Dresden, IfWW, MBZ, Professur für Biomaterialien, Prof. Hans Peter Wiesmann
-
07/2020 – 06/2021: Postdoctoral researcher, DFG SFB1270 ELAINE, University of Rostock, Institute of General Electrical Engineering, Chair of Electromagnetic Field Theory, Prof. Dr. Ursula van Rienen. Topic: “In silico modelling and investigating the synergistic effects of TLC-EF stimulation and bioactive glass nanoparticles on osteogenic differentiation of human mesenchymal stem cells”
-
01/2019 – 06/2020: Postdoctoral researcher, DFG SFB Transregio 67 Project A03, TU Dresden, IfWW, MBZ, Professur für Biomaterialien, Group Functional Biomaterials (PD Dr. Vera Hintze), Topic: “Investigation of the osteogenic potential of 3D composite hydrogels functionalized with glycosaminoglycan (GAG) artificial extracellular matrices (aECM) and bioactive glass nanoparticles (BGN)”
-
2014 - 2018: PhD; Dr.-Ing.; Title of PhD Thesis: “Establishing a biomimetic bioreactor: Recapitulating physiological niches in vitro to derive tailored bone-like constructs with human mesenchymal stem cells.“ TU Dresden, IfWW, MBZ, Professur für Biomaterialien, Prof. Dieter Scharnweber
-
2009 - 2012: M.Sc. Biomedical Engineering; Title of M.Sc. Thesis: “Developing a novel biomimetic bioreactor for bone graft engineering with murine embryonic stem cells“; University of Calgary, McCaig Institute for Bone and Joint Health, Alberta, Canada. Assistant Professor Roman Krawetz.
-
2006 - 2009: Bachelor of Health Science (B.hSc.; Biomedical Sciences); Title of B.hSc. Thesis: “Generating Stem-cell derived Cardiomyocytes with Murine Cardiac Extracellular Matrix (Cardiogel)” O´Brien Center for Bachelor of Health Sciences, University of Calgary, Alberta, Canada. Prof. Derrick Rancourt.
Research Profile and Competence
-
Developing customised bioreactors for bone and vascular tissue engineering and dynamic co-culture of osteoblast/osteocyte/osteoclast
-
Designing and applying pulsatile electrical stimulation regimes to enhance osteogenic differentiation of human mesenchymal stem cell
-
pO2 manipulation/documentation and cell culture in hypoxic chamber (OxylitePro, HypoxyLab)
-
Synthesizing and Characterising biomaterials for bone regeneration
-
Collagen-based cryogels and hydrogels
-
Porosity, Swelling behavior
-
Release behavior of glycosaminoglycans, ions
-
Mechanical characterization
-
-
Stem cell expansion using spinner flask bioreactor and micro-carriers.
-
Cell culturing techniques (human and murine stem cells (embryonic/mesenchymal), primary fibroblasts, small cell lung lymphoma primary cells)
